How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Caroline?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Caroline Studio Apartments | $1,369 | $950 | $2,650 |
| Caroline 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,916 | $695 | $3,040 |
| Caroline 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,173 | $871 | $4,400 |
| Caroline 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,941 | $948 | $4,900 |
| Caroline 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,600 | $3,900 | $7,200 |
